Deda hospital, located in Abuja, seeks the services of qualified candidates to provide medical support to patients, to fill the position below:
Job Title: Medical Officer
Location: Abuja
Job Duties
Provide acute and ongoing medical care to patients
Provide general practitioner services to patients
Carry out tasks appropriate to family medicine and primary care
Provide emergency and after hours medical services on a rostered basis
Collaborate with other consultants , while taking deliveries
Participate in the management of the Hospital
Making of diagnoses and the recommending of treatments
Carry out interpretation of examination findings and the results of tests
Organising of patient disposal.
Job Title: Registered Nurse / Registered Midwife
Location: Abuja
Position Summary
This position will provide a high quality and effective service of assessment, support, advice and referral to enhance health, safety and well-being through involvement with pregnant and postnatal women, as well as other Acute unit patients.
Job Description
As a midwife, to provide quality care to midwifery patients during all stages of their pregnancy.
Provide support and assistance to new mothers including breastfeeding advice and assistance with general parent crafting.
Be available for "on call" roster as required to provide escort for midwifery patient requiring transfer or assistance if more than one patient in Delivery Suite.
Provide quality nursing care that includes assessment, planning and evaluation of care.
Attend relative study days/seminars to maintain current level of knowledge in all aspects of midwifery/medical/surgical nursing.
Identifies learning needs and actions as able, or discusses with the relevant manager either before or during regular performance review processes.
Active participation in Health Service activities and meetings.
Maintain interest and understanding of current trends in nursing and in the healthcare industry.
Demonstrate a professional approach in regard to time keeping, appearance and behaviour.
Excellence in customer service, facilitating relations with patients, extended families, friends and the broader community
Provide emergency care and advice to patients presenting to the emergency department as required.
Demonstrate competency in professional and clinical skills.
Ensure appropriate documentation and discharge planning for patients as required.
To effectively and efficiently use ward equipment and supplies.
To communicate effectively with patients, nursing colleagues and all members of the healthcare team.
Liaise with medical, allied health and other nursing staff to ensure continuity of patient care.
Maintain interest and understanding of current trends in nursing and in the healthcare industry.
Demonstrate a professional approach in regard to time keeping, appearance and behaviour.
Excellence in customer service, facilitating relations with patients, extended families, friends and the broader community.
Practices in accordance with the Deda Hospital’s Vision, Values and Core Objectives
Requirements
Essentials:
Clinical knowledge and skills related to maternity services.
Clinical knowledge and skills related to acute, medical/surgical services
Previous experience as a Registered Nurse / Registered Midwife, either in a generalist setting or maternity services.
Sound interpersonal and communication skills
Ability to operate effectively in an environment of change and continuous improvement
Experience working independently
Computer skills
Problem Solving Skills
Demonstrated ability to manage resources effectively
Desirable:
Maternal Child Health Qualifications
Minimum two years’ experience.
Knowledge of current issues, trends and research in acute services and maternity services / early years
